Transaction b896a6989277c4febd894a6ce577c1fe38bde87b66cf2ee850d86c0aa7e49f5f

1 Input
2 Outputs
  • b896a6989277c4febd894a6ce577c1fe38bde87b66cf2ee850d86c0aa7e49f5f:0
  • value  38627424
    address  1HDcdk63q6q756udFzNt18RaqQw2fr3cfA
  • b896a6989277c4febd894a6ce577c1fe38bde87b66cf2ee850d86c0aa7e49f5f:1
  • value  112000000
    address  3CdwEHSZjaog9tWBbYKHUQTFJ71p9VeSme